Job Description

A client within the Public Sector based in Wrexham is currently recruiting for a Housing Repairs Manager to join their Housing & Assets team as soon as possible. The client is offering a full-time, temporary position on an ongoing basis with the ideal candidate having experience of working within a local authority within a housing or property services environment. The Role Key purpose of the role is to be responsible for the delivery of a range of services under the Property Service portfolio, including leading the day-to-day effectiveness of Housing Repairs, the DLO repairs operation and servicing/cyclical works. This includes continually improving efficiency, productivity and optimising resources to meet fluctuating service demands. The post will provide operational and strategic support to lead officers in managing housing operations, DLO management and external contracts, while also supporting wider strategic initiatives across the department. Key responsibilities will include but not be limited to: • Manage day-to-day operations of DLO and external contracts • Lead the delivery and performance of Housing Repairs, ensuring effective resource allocation • Support specialist programmes including cyclical painting, domestic servicing, specialist maintenance, housing disrepair and damp, HAVS management, and out-of-hours response • Collaborate with internal teams to review performance and streamline processes • Work closely with Voids & Decarbonisation Lead and Investment & Delivery Lead The Candidate To be considered for this role you will require: • Proven experience in housing operations or contract management • Strong organisational and communication skills • Ability to work collaboratively across teams and departments The below skills would be beneficial for the role: • Experience with Direct Labour Organisation (DLO) operations • Knowledge of housing compliance and legislative frameworks • Experience supporting strategic projects within a local authority The client is looking to move quickly with this role and as such are offering £29 per hour Umbrella LTD Inside IR35 (approx. £23 per hour PAYE).
